在网页设计与开发过程中,图片扮演着至关重要的角色。它们能够生动展现内容,提升用户体验。然而,图片之间常常会出现一些不必要的空白符,这些空白符不仅影响页面的整体美观,还可能对页面加载速度造成一定影响。
特别是在响应式设计中,空白符的问题尤为突出。不同屏幕尺寸下,空白符可能导致图片排列错乱,严重影响用户体验。因此,去除图片之间的空白符成为开发过程中不可忽视的一环。浩发科技作为专业的软件开发公司,深知这一痛点,接下来将为你分享几种高效去除空白符的方法。
1. **使用CSS Flexbox布局** Flexbox(弹性盒模型)是CSS3中引入的一种布局方式,它允许容器内的项目能够在需要时伸缩其尺寸。通过为图片容器设置`display: flex;`,可以轻松实现图片间的无缝排列,从而去除空白符。
2. **利用CSS Grid布局** Grid布局是另一种强大的CSS布局方式,它允许你创建复杂的网格布局。通过为图片容器设置`display: grid;`,并指定适当的网格模板,可以轻松实现图片间的无缝排列。
在某些情况下,你可能需要更灵活地调整图片之间的空白符。这时,JavaScript可以发挥重要作用。通过JavaScript,你可以动态检测图片尺寸和容器宽度,然后调整图片之间的间距或重新排列图片。
例如,你可以使用JavaScript遍历图片容器中的所有图片元素,计算它们的总宽度和容器宽度,然后根据差值调整图片之间的间距。这种方法虽然相对复杂,但能够提供更灵活和动态的布局调整方案。
作为一家专业的软件开发公司,浩发科技在图像处理与优化方面积累了丰富的经验。接下来,我们将分享一个实战案例,展示如何在项目中高效去除图片之间的空白符。
在某电商项目中,客户要求实现一个商品图片轮播功能。在开发过程中,我们发现图片之间存在一定的空白符,影响了页面的整体美观。为了解决这个问题,我们采用了CSS Grid布局,并设置了适当的网格模板和间距。同时,我们还利用JavaScript动态检测图片尺寸和容器宽度,确保在不同屏幕尺寸下图片能够无缝排列。最终,我们成功去除了图片之间的空白符,为客户提供了一个高质量的电商页面。
去除图片之间的空白符是网页设计与开发过程中的一项重要任务。通过HTML、CSS和JavaScript等技术的综合运用,我们可以轻松实现这一目标。然而,技术的迭代与更新永无止境。作为开发者,我们应该保持持续学习的态度,不断探索新的技术和方法,以追求更加卓越的开发成果。
浩发科技始终秉持“技术创新、质量至上”的理念,致力于为客户提供高质量的软件开发服务。在未来的发展中,我们将继续深耕图像处理与优化领域,为客户提供更加优质、高效的解决方案。
除了去除图片之间的空白符外,图像处理与优化还包括许多其他方面。以下是一些实用的小贴士,帮助你提升网页性能与用户体验:
浩发科技在图像处理与优化领域一直保持着领先地位。我们不断探索新的技术和方法,以帮助客户提升网页性能与用户体验。以下是我们在该领域的一些探索和实践: